Chicken in French
4 servings
45 minutes
French-style chicken is a tender and aromatic dish inspired by classic French cuisine. Its roots trace back to the famous 'meat à la française,' but this version uses chicken fillet, making it lighter and more dietary. Potatoes form a soft base, absorbing juices and spices, while juicy tomatoes add a refreshing tang. Garlic adds zest, and the golden crust of baked cheese makes the dish particularly appetizing. This recipe is perfect for a cozy family dinner or festive gathering, delighting with its rich flavor and simplicity of preparation.

1
French-style meat alternative: layer sliced potatoes, chopped chicken fillet, sliced tomatoes, pieces of garlic on a baking sheet, and top with grated cheese. Don't forget to sprinkle with salt and pepper to taste.
- Potato: 5 piece
- Chicken fillet: 1 kg
- Tomatoes: 4 pieces
- Garlic: 2 cloves
- Cheese: 300 g
- Salt: to taste
- Ground black pepper: to taste
2
Bake in the oven at 180 degrees for about half an hour.
